پروژه پایگاه داده باشگاه ورزشی با SQL Server یکی از کاربردیترین و پرطرفدارترین پروژههای آموزشی برای دانشجویان رشته کامپیوتر است. این پروژه با هدف مدیریت جامع اطلاعات اعضا، مربیان، کلاسها، رزروها و پرداختها طراحی شده و نمونهای بسیار مناسب برای تمرین و یادگیری مفاهیم طراحی پایگاه داده در محیط SQL Server میباشد.
درس بانک اطلاعاتی Sql Server از اساسیترین دروس رشته کامپیوتر به شمار میرود، زیرا بسیاری از نرمافزارها و سیستمهای اطلاعاتی بر پایه بانک داده طراحی میشوند. این پروژه با ساختار منظم و استاندارد خود، به دانشجویان کمک میکند تا ارتباط بین جداول، کلیدهای اصلی و خارجی، Viewها و کوئریهای پیچیده را بهتر درک کنند.
تکنولوژیها و ابزارهای استفاده شده
در طراحی این پروژه از ابزارها و مفاهیم حرفهای زیر استفاده شده است:
- نرمافزار Microsoft SQL Server
- طراحی جداول با روابط منطقی و کلیدهای اصلی (Primary Key) و خارجی (Foreign Key)
- استفاده از View برای نمایش دادههای ترکیبی
- طراحی دیاگرام ER جهت نمایش ارتباط بین جداول
- کوئری نویسی و دستورات SQL برای مدیریت دادهها (Select، Insert، Update، Delete)
- فایل بکآپ بانک اطلاعاتی با فرمت
.bakجهت بازیابی آسان
این مجموعه باعث میشود پروژه آماده اجرا و آزمایش برای دانشجویان و علاقهمندان به بانک اطلاعاتی باشد.
ساختار جداول پروژه باشگاه ورزشی
در این بانک اطلاعاتی، جداول اصلی به صورت دقیق و هدفمند طراحی شدهاند تا تمامی بخشهای یک باشگاه ورزشی را پوشش دهند:
- جدول اعضا (Member): شامل اطلاعات شخصی اعضای باشگاه مانند نام، سن، شماره تماس و نوع عضویت.
- جدول مربیان (Trainers): شامل اطلاعات مربیان، تخصصها، زمان کاری و کلاسهای مرتبط.
- جدول کلاسها (Classes): شامل نام کلاس، نوع ورزش، مربی مسئول، ظرفیت و زمانبندی هر کلاس.
- جدول رزرو کلاسها (Bookings): شامل اطلاعات مربوط به رزرو کلاسها توسط اعضا و جزئیات ثبت نام.
- جدول پرداختها (Payments): شامل مشخصات پرداختها، مبلغ، تاریخ و نوع تراکنش هر عضو.
تمامی این جداول با کلیدهای منطقی به یکدیگر مرتبط شدهاند و به شکل استاندارد در دیاگرام ER نمایش داده میشوند.
امکانات پروژه پایگاه داده باشگاه ورزشی با SQL Server
این پروژه دارای بخشهای متعدد و آموزشی زیر است:
- بخش جداول: شامل تصاویر محیط طراحی (Design) جداول و دادههای وارد شده.
- بخش View: نمایش دادههای ترکیبی با استفاده از Viewهای تعریفشده برای دسترسی سریعتر به اطلاعات.
- بخش دیاگرام ER: نمودار رابطه بین جداول برای درک ارتباط دادهها به صورت گرافیکی.
- فایل دیتابیس (.bak): نسخه قابل بازیابی بانک اطلاعاتی همراه پروژه برای تست و بررسی در SQL Server.
- بخش کوئری نویسی: شامل مجموعهای از حدود ۱۵ کوئری کاربردی برای تمرین عملیات مختلف بر روی دادههای بانک اطلاعاتی باشگاه.
نمونه کوئریها شامل دستورات جستجو، فیلتر اعضا بر اساس کلاس، محاسبه پرداختها، و ترکیب چند جدول برای گزارشگیری هستند.
مزایای آموزشی و کاربردی پروژه باشگاه ورزشی
- یادگیری عملی طراحی بانک اطلاعاتی در محیط SQL Server
- آشنایی با انواع روابط بین جداول و ساختار پایگاه دادهها
- تمرین کوئری نویسی و طراحی Viewها
- آشنایی با دیاگرام ER و ارتباطات دادهای
- مناسب برای پروژههای درس پایگاه داده در دانشگاه
- قابل توسعه به سیستمهای مدیریتی بزرگتر مانند سامانه ثبت نام یا پرداخت اینترنتی
- درک دقیق فرآیندهای واقعی در سیستمهای اطلاعاتی مانند مدیریت باشگاهها، مدارس یا دورههای آموزشی
نحوه راهاندازی و اجرای پروژه بانک اطلاعاتی باشگاه ورزشی
برای استفاده از این پروژه، مراحل زیر را دنبال کنید:
- نرمافزار SQL Server Management Studio را نصب کرده باشید.
- فایل .bak پروژه را در مسیر
Backupبازیابی کنید تا بانک اطلاعاتی ساخته شود. - وارد پایگاه داده شوید و بخشهای مختلف شامل جداول، Viewها و کوئریها را بررسی کنید.
- میتوانید با اجرای کوئریهای موجود، عملکرد واقعی سیستم را مشاهده نمایید.
- برای تمرین و یادگیری بهتر، پیشنهاد میشود تغییراتی روی دادهها و کوئریها اعمال کنید تا فرآیندهای منطقی را درک کنید.
کاربردهای واقعی پروژه
این پروژه علاوه بر جنبه آموزشی، در کاربردهای عملی نیز قابل استفاده است، از جمله:
- سیستم مدیریت باشگاههای بدنسازی و فیتنس
- سامانه رزرو کلاسهای ورزشی
- مدیریت پرداختهای اعضای باشگاه
- پروژه دانشجویی و تحقیقاتی حوزه پایگاه داده
- تمرین تخصصی برای علاقهمندان به SQL Server و کوئرینویسی حرفهای
جمعبندی
پروژه پایگاه داده باشگاه ورزشی با SQL Server نمونهای کامل، آموزشی و استاندارد است که با رعایت اصول طراحی دیتابیس، جداول مرتبط و کوئریهای عملی، به دانشجویان کمک میکند تا مفاهیم پایگاه داده را به شکل کاربردی بیاموزند. این پروژه هم برای اجرا و تست عملی مناسب است و هم به عنوان پروژه پایانی درس پایگاه داده در دانشگاه قابل ارائه است.
سفارش پروژه برنامه نویسی سفارش ، دانلود و انجام پروژه برنامه نویسی